The new-and-improved L.E.A.P. (Language Engagement and Activities Program) is designed for students who love learning languages and exploring the cultures they shape. This multi-day experience will foster immersive language practice and authentic cultural exchange via faculty-guided language activities as well as Spanish/Hispanic- and Italian-themed cultural events (e.g. a cooking class, dinner at a local ethnic restaurant, a trip to the Planet Word in DC, and more!). In addition, students will learn about ways to maximize their language study at Loyola (language clubs, majors/minors, etc.) and meet current language students who will help them acclimate to campus and college living.
